Peewee Piemonte, a veteran in the Entertainment industry, is a two-time Emmy winner and four-time Emmy nominee. Born in the Bronx, Peewee earned his nickname in the 4th grade, due to being the biggest kid in school. He learned to accept and turn his size into an asset, winning his class in bodybuilding in the JR America.
Success in bodybuilding led to a seamless transition into commercials, where Peewee began his entertainment industry career. On a commercial shoot, he was introduced to stunts and stuntmen, and his focus shifted to turning his winning athleticism into making top-tier action for television and film.
With skill, build, and determination, Peewee's career thrived quickly. He has virtually done it all, traversing from stuntman to stunt coordinator, to second unit director, and now award-winning Director for his emotional feature "Last Writes". His Best Director Award was a product of the great performance he received from legendary actor, Lance Henriksen's portrayal of Robert Service, hiding his love affair with a soldier in the war in 1941.
Peewee is a former Vice President and now Lifetime Member of the Stuntmen's Association of Motion Pictures (S.A.M.P.). He is a Stunt Rigger, Stunt Driver, and former Instructor for ROCO - Confined space, structural, and high-angle rescue.
Throughout his 36-year career, Peewee boasts over 300 professional entertainment credits on shows such as "Seal Team" for CBS, "Jane The Virgin" for CW, "How To Get Away With Murder" for ABC, and "The Newsroom" for Aaron Sorkin/HBO. He has also worked on shows like "Person of Interest", "Monday Mornings", "Unaccompanied Minors", "Vacancy 2", "Numb3rs", "The Defenders", "CSI Miami", and "What Just Happened" starring Robert DeNiro.
Peewee is also President of JMP Productions Inc, where he and his wife, Julie Michaels, have forged a brand of Action Direction on the foundation of ability, trust, integrity, and ethics. Their commitment to employing hundreds of Veterans in performing positions on the shows they coordinate is a testament to their values.
